Abstract

The paper approaches the problem of power control in mobile wireless networks. We aim at solving the trade-off between conflicting constraints on the bounds of the two relevant variables of the system - the power and the signal-to-interference ratio (SIR) - that is to keep the SIR at a high value with a low power. One of the challenges refers to the partial controlability of the system. We solve the control problem by taking advantage of the inherent system nonlinearities.
